i just bought a 1992 chevrolet cavalier as is (of course). its a 2.2 L. 4 cyl. manual and when i push in the clutch pedal it makes a knocking sound. i checked the tranny fluid and there is a little too much fluid in it. could that be the problem? also, i had the front of the car on jack stands and i started it and it made no noises, so now i’m confused. as soon as i get a chance i will drain the extra fluid but i just wanted an educated opinion. thanx ahead for any info

The problem isn’t in the tranny. I suspect you have a worn out release bearing (also commonly called a throwout bearing). You may even have a bad pressure plate. Anyway, they’re all part of a “clutch kit” and all get changed together during a clutch replacement.
